  1. Blair Cowan (born 21 April 1986) is a Scottish rugby union player with Black Rams Tokyo. He also plays for the San Diego Legion of Major League Rugby (MLR) in the U.S. He plays as a number eight or flanker.

  2. Blair Cowan is a Scottish musician, formerly a member of Lloyd Cole and the Commotions. Following the breakup of that band, he continued to collaborate with Lloyd Cole early in the singer's solo career, playing and co-writing on 1990's Lloyd Cole and 1991's Don't Get Weird on Me Babe.
